HB 3627
Texas House Bill
Did you know we offer free bill tracking in Congress and 50 states, AI tools to streamline your work, and a great mobile app? Sign up here
Relating to the authority of a governmental body impacted by a catastrophe to temporarily suspend the requirements of the public information law.
